where's my code?
使用InstanceType获取组件的类型 使用InstanceType获取组件的类型
1. InstanceType作用&使用1.1 前言: 使用defineComponent的vue组件,导出的是一个对象👇🏻(里面将对象传给了defineComponent方法,但它还会返回出来) 👆🏻这个组件经de
2023-01-07
使用TS封装axios 使用TS封装axios
大致步骤👇🏻(PS:过程中的代码可能不是最终的,可以在后面看最终的总结及代码。) 1. 封装 axios 实例 封装后可以 new 出多个实例,每个实例可以有不同的 BASE_URL 等。 1.1 使用 class 封装 axios
2022-12-11
关于TS中描述Object类型的两种方式(类型签名和Record) 关于TS中描述Object类型的两种方式(类型签名和Record)
前言 :由于 Object 的范围很大,对象中属性可能是任意类型,而这时区分不出一个 Object 具体是什么类型。 所以一般不在 TS 中直接使用 Object 类型,而是以下两种方式描述对象: class / constructor;
2022-12-10
vuex4 & 结合TS的特殊处理 vuex4 & 结合TS的特殊处理
1. 关于vuex4store/index.js文件: 调用createStore创建仓库,它里面传入的是一个对象; createStore会接收一个泛型, // 先引入: import { createStore }